Clinical Effects of Keratinized Mucosa Augmentation Around Dental Implant With Free Gingival Graft in Different Surgical Timing at Mandibular Posterior Sites

Sponsor: The Dental Hospital of Zhejiang University School of Medicine

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

This study aims to compare clinical outcomes and tissue stability at implant sites in the mandibular posterior region with insufficient buccal keratinized gingiva. It will assess the use of free gingival grafts either before or during the second stage of implant surgery.

Interventions

PROCEDURE

free gingival grafts during the second stage of implant surgery

Free gingival graft surgery performed simultaneously with implant stage II, followed by upper restoration 6-8 weeks later.

PROCEDURE

free gingival grafts prior to the implantaion

Free gingival graft surgery performed 6-8 weeks before implant placement
